Many places supply them and also supply good and bad examples so hunt around especially where shipping is likely.

The Canadian-made Spectra Premium tanks are among the best. You want the GM203 model. I now have this tank after shipping it around the world. I also tried the Spectra Taiwanese-made standard tank and it didn't fit very well and was returned. This same tank is probably marketed under several names.

Here's the good one:

I bought a stainless steel fuel tank from rockauto, maybe 2 weeks ago.

Needs to grind of a bit from the filler neck. But after all, a great investment. It will never rust again  ;D
